How much does siding replacement cost in Haverhill, MA?

Most siding replacement projects in Haverhill run between $10,000 and $30,000 depending on the size of your home, the material you choose, and what we find when we remove the old siding. Vinyl is the most affordable option and requires almost no maintenance. Fiber cement costs more upfront but recoups about 86% of the cost when you sell, compared to 68% for vinyl.

If we find rot or structural damage underneath your current siding, that adds to the cost because it has to be fixed before we install anything new. We’ll let you know during the estimate if we see signs of moisture damage so there aren’t surprises later.

The ROI on siding replacement is strong. For every $10,000 you spend, you’re typically adding $7,000+ in home value. And that doesn’t account for the energy savings or the fact that you won’t be repainting or patching failing siding every few years.

Fiber cement and insulated vinyl both handle Haverhill’s climate well. Fiber cement doesn’t warp or crack from temperature swings, and it’s not affected by moisture the way wood siding is. It’s heavier and costs more to install, but it lasts 30+ years with minimal upkeep.

Insulated vinyl is lighter, easier to install, and provides better energy efficiency than standard vinyl. It holds up to freezing temps and won’t fade as quickly in the sun. The insulation backing also reduces drafts and helps with temperature consistency inside your home.

Wood siding looks great on historic homes in Haverhill, but it requires regular staining or painting, and it’s vulnerable to rot if moisture gets trapped behind it. If you’re set on the look of wood, engineered wood is a middle ground that’s more durable and needs less maintenance than traditional cedar or pine.

Most residential siding installations in Haverhill, MA take between three and seven days depending on the size of your home and the complexity of the job. A straightforward ranch with minimal trim work might be done in three days. A two-story colonial with dormers, bay windows, and detailed trim could take a full week.

Weather can slow things down. We don’t install siding in heavy rain or freezing temperatures because the materials won’t seal properly and moisture can get trapped. If the forecast looks bad, we’ll pause the job and pick it back up when conditions improve.

Commercial projects take longer because of the square footage and the need to coordinate around business hours. We’ll give you a timeline during the estimate and keep you updated if anything changes once we start.

It depends on the extent of the damage and the age of your current siding. If you’ve got a few cracked or broken panels and the rest of the siding is in good shape, we can replace those sections. The challenge is matching the color and texture, especially if your siding has been up for a while and has faded.

If more than 30% of your siding is damaged, or if it’s over 20 years old, replacement usually makes more sense than patching. Older siding is more likely to have hidden moisture damage, and you’ll end up replacing it in sections over the next few years anyway. Doing it all at once saves you money in the long run and gives you a consistent look.

Look for visible cracks, holes, or panels that are pulling away from the house. If you see warping or buckling, that’s a sign the material has been expanding and contracting from temperature changes and is no longer structurally sound. Peeling paint or faded color means the siding has reached the end of its lifespan and isn’t protecting the exterior anymore.

Check inside your home too. Peeling wallpaper, bubbling paint, or mold on interior walls near the exterior can indicate that moisture is getting through the siding and into the framing. That’s a bigger problem than cosmetic damage because it means the structure is at risk.

If your energy bills have been climbing without explanation, that’s another red flag. Damaged siding lets drafts in and makes your heating and cooling systems work overtime.
